How much do at home bank j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 27, 2026, the average hourly pay for at home bank in Boca Raton, FL is $16.32,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$12.79 and $20.53 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Job Summary and Qualifications

Provides coordinated skilled nursing care to patients of all age groups, in the home. Demonstrates accountability and responsibility in collaborating with the interdisciplinary team to establish and achieve patient goals and maintain high quality patient care. Performs in accordance with physician’s orders and under the supervision of the Clinical Manager.

What you will do in this role:

  • Assesses home care patients identifying physical, psychosocial and environmental needs as evidenced by documentation, clinical records, case conferences, team reports, call-in logs and on-site evaluations.
  • Completes OASIS, assessment and visit paperwork according to agency policy. Assures clinical notes accurately indicate continuing communication and coordination of services with the physician, other interdisciplinary team members and patient/family/caregiver.
  • Communicates significant findings, problems and changes to Clinical Manager and physician, and documents all findings, communications, and appropriate interventions.
  • Supervises and provides clinical direction to home health aides and LPNs/LVNs to ensure quality and continuity of services provided.
  • Responsible for participating in on-call rotation and emergency call according to agency policy.
What qualifications you will need:
  • Graduate of an accredited Registered Nursing program

  • Minimum of one (1) year experience as a Registered Nurse preferred
  • Current State RN License
  • Reliable transportation and proof of valid automobile liability insurance
  • Must have valid driver’s license
